Acerca de este mapa
Nombre: Mapa topográfico El Quinche, altitud, relieve.
Lugar: El Quinche, Quito Canton, Pichincha, 170911, Ecuador (-0.19010 -78.35080 -0.06763 -78.16490)
Altitud media: 2.868 m
Altitud mínima: 1.848 m
Altitud máxima: 4.422 m
